A couple of days ago I was driving through Homewood Alabama and found a little piece of heaven on earth. Let me be precise though, the little piece of heaven on earth was not the place, but the bite of cake (or Baby Bites as they call them) that I put in my mouth. My first bite was of their Red Velvet Baby Bite. (Dennis Gregg, their General Manager, has been told its the best Red Velvet Cake in town, and it just may be!) The creator of this heavenly delights was the Pastry Arts Bake Shoppe. I have found out that even most of those who live in Homewood Alabama don’t even know they are there… yet!
